在如今的网络环境中,保护个人隐私和安全变得越来越重要。很多用户选择使用代理工具来保障他们的网络安全,其中阿里云的WS与V2Ray是两个非常受欢迎的工具。本篇文章将详细介绍如何在阿里云上配置和使用WS与V2Ray,帮助用户搭建一个安全稳定的网络环境。
1. 什么是WS与V2Ray?
1.1 WS(WebSocket)
WebSocket 是一种在单个TCP连接上进行全双工通信的协议,它常用于实现网页与服务器之间的实时交互。在V2Ray中,WS通常用于搭建与服务器之间的安全连接。
1.2 V2Ray
V2Ray 是一款优秀的网络代理工具,能够实现多种协议的网络转发。它以高度的灵活性和可配置性著称,支持多种传输协议,如TCP、UDP、mKCP、WebSocket等。
2. 阿里云的优势
使用阿里云搭建WS与V2Ray具有以下优势:
- 高可用性:阿里云的服务器稳定性高,能够提供持续的服务。
- 安全性:通过加密技术保护用户的数据,避免信息泄露。
- 易于管理:阿里云提供用户友好的控制面板,使得管理和监控变得简单。
3. 如何在阿里云上配置WS与V2Ray
3.1 创建阿里云账号
如果还没有阿里云账号,首先需要在阿里云官网注册一个账号。
3.2 购买ECS实例
- 登录阿里云控制台。
- 选择“计算”中的“弹性云服务器(ECS)”。
- 点击“创建实例”,选择适合的配置(建议选择较新的操作系统,如Ubuntu 20.04)。
- 完成付款并记下服务器的公网IP。
3.3 安装V2Ray
在ECS实例中安装V2Ray,步骤如下:
-
连接到服务器:使用SSH工具(如Putty)连接到ECS实例。
-
执行安装命令:在终端中运行以下命令:
bash
bash <(curl -s -L https://raw.githubusercontent.com/v2fly/fhs-install-v2ray/master/install.sh) -
检查安装是否成功:运行
v2ray version
查看版本号。
3.4 配置V2Ray
-
打开配置文件
nano /etc/v2ray/config.json
。 -
根据需求修改配置文件,例如:
- 修改 outbounds,确保使用WS协议。
- 配置 inbounds,确保V2Ray可以接收来自客户端的请求。
-
保存并退出文件。
3.5 启动V2Ray
执行以下命令启动V2Ray服务: bash systemctl start v2ray systemctl enable v2ray
4. 配置客户端
为了使用WS与V2Ray,用户需要配置客户端。
- 使用V2RayN或V2RayNG等客户端工具,导入配置文件,设置服务器地址为阿里云的公网IP,配置端口、UUID等信息。
5. 测试连接
在客户端连接到服务器,访问网页或使用网络工具检查是否能够正常上网,以确保WS与V2Ray配置成功。
6. 常见问题解答(FAQ)
6.1 阿里云WS与V2Ray的费用高吗?
阿里云的ECS实例费用根据所选的配置、地区和使用时长而异。通常可以选择较低配置的实例,费用会更低。用户可以根据实际需求灵活调整配置。
6.2 如何确保我的V2Ray连接安全?
- 定期更新V2Ray到最新版本,及时修补漏洞。
- 使用复杂的UUID和安全的传输协议。
- 配置TLS加密以增加安全性。
6.3 如果V2Ray无法连接怎么办?
- 检查配置文件是否正确。
- 确保阿里云安全组已开放对应端口。
- 通过日志查看连接失败的具体原因。
6.4 是否可以在手机上使用V2Ray?
是的,用户可以在手机上安装V2RayNG或Shadowrocket等应用,通过配置与阿里云的V2Ray服务器进行连接。
结论
通过以上步骤,用户可以在阿里云上成功配置WS与V2Ray,实现安全、稳定的网络连接。希望本文能为你提供有价值的信息,帮助你更好地使用阿里云的服务。